What is SEO (Search Engine Optimization)?
Search Engine Optimization is otherwise known as "SEO", is one of the best tools that companies have in terms of increasing your overall visibility online. It allows them to bring in more visitors through natural or free organic search results. The 3 big search engines like Google, Bing, and Yahoo rank websites based on thousands of varying factors that they deem most important and they do so free of charge. By optimizing your site and a few technical aspects you will start increasing your rank in the search engines results, you will gain more visibility and will, in turn, see an increase in visitor traffic to your website.
Do you know the difference between Local Search and Organic Search?
Organic traffic refers to the traffic that comes to your site thru the search engines that is not paid traffic. Organic Results is basically when a person goes to google and types in a search term and the results appear, well that is the SERP page or Search engine results page. On that page, there are paid ads on top and organic results below them. Local Search is also known as the "map results" or "snack pack", its function is to display local results for people who are in a particular distance from the business or people who search geographic based terms. One example would be "Miami SEO" or "SEO in Florida", geographic term + business.

Is there such a thing as Bad SEO?
Some people have tried to work around good search engine optimization to include their website higher in the search engine ranks. Search engines like Google have cracked down on the practices I’ve listed below. If you are using these to try to boost your search engine ranking, it may actually be harming you.
-
Duplicate Content - Creating unique content is very important. Search engines will not index pages with similar content as it has nothing new to offer. Creating pages with similar information may be necessary, but you will need to make sure you select those pages to not be followed or indexed. Otherwise, they will be detrimental to your ranking.
-
Giving Guest Posts - Once a common practice, guest posts provided a way to offer businesses exposure. If it is not carried out properly, it can pose a problem to your businesses web rankings.
-
Receiving Guest Posts - To create unique content, often \websites will allow guests to post. Be sure to use guest posts that are relevant and unique to your service or brand.
-
An abundance of Outgoing Links - While outside links are important, creating too many will flag your site as a paid directory or link farm.
-
Ads Above the Fold - Google recently configured their algorithm to include pages that had too many ads above the fold.
